Julio Borbón

Julio Alberto Borbón (born February 20, 1986) is an American former professional baseball center fielder and current Assistant Coordinator of Player Development for the Minnesota Twins. He played in Major League Baseball (MLB) for the Texas Rangers, Chicago Cubs, and Baltimore Orioles. He also played for the Sultanes de Monterrey, Pericos de Puebla, and the Acereros de Monclova of the Mexican Baseball League.
